Myself and Berg actually considered this a few weeks back when we were taking a look at 2.X double boosts.
With 2.X you just can't afford to throw the first grenade any later than during the first right turn onto the slide, because you need to start priming the 2nd grenade otherwise it won't explode. So changing to right strafe there doesn't really make that throw much less difficult (you can do it mid-turn in left strafe too), and the strafe change would lose more than 0.1. Also you are relying on a good bounce off of the wall since putting that grenade in the corner on the right of the door is actually a bad spot, ideally you want it on the left side of the door for a better boost.
Finally you have to do the hut in left strafe (else big time loss) so you would have to change back at the door. This might not lose more than like 0.05 (the door opening is a bit of a bottleneck) but it also prevents you from warping the door which I think can save 0.1. So compared to a safe single it wouldn't be worth it.

Is there a way to cook immediately, throw a nade at the door, throw another nade at the outside wall to the right of the door, boost yourself in and boost yourself out?
no time, you already have to prime the nade at the slide anyways which is pretty much 1 second into the run
since you are at the hut door like 3 seconds into the run, it wouldn't be able to explode no matter how early you prime

Wherever you place the grenade it's impossible to avoid a back boost (or two) when exiting the hut. Also the earliest a primed grenade can explode is about 0.5s after you pick up the key (on TAS pace) so there's no chance of a boost before the key.
Key first, then (non-TAS) boosts
